Bush’s My Lai Massacre
May 29th, 2006The latest war-crimes scandal in Iraq - the alleged murder of two dozen Iraqis in Haditha at the hands of U.S. Marines - is drawing comparisons to the Vietnam War’s My Lai massacre. But the bigger issue is whether George W. Bush should be held accountable since he misled both the American public and U.S. troops into believing that the invasion of Iraq was a way to avenge the 9/11 attacks - a lie that created the conditions for atrocities.
